Roaming User Always Break Lock=0/1
Default: 0 (selected)
Ask before breaking locks on network user
profiles (recommended) check box:
If set to 0, Dragon warns users if they attempt to
open a Roaming user profile that is already in
use. The prompt states that the user profile is
locked and offers the option to unlock the profile.
Network problems can cause a lock to become
“stuck” and not release.
If set to 1, Dragon breaks the lock automatically
without producing a prompt.
Roaming ASW Override=0/1
ASW Override=0/1
Default: 0 (deselected)
Set audio levels on each machine check box:
If set to 0, Dragon runs a Volume and Quality
Check on the microphone each time a user opens
a Roaming user profile.
If set to 1, Dragon skips the microphone check.
ASW Override and Roaming ASW Override
should always have the same setting.
NMS settings
For information on installing and configuring the NMC server, see the Nuance Management Center
Server Installation and Configuration Guide.
Option Description and user interface equivalent
Connect To NMS=0/1
Default: 0 (deselected)
Enable NMS check box:
If set to 1, enables Nuance Management Center/NMS
mode.
If set to 0, disables Nuance Management Center/NMS
mode. Dragon is in Standalone mode.
Default NAS Address=
<full NMC address>
Default: None
Server field:
Directs the Dragon client to the NMC cloud server or your
on-premise server.
